  • Abstract
    We construct a spin foam model of Yang–Mills theory coupled to gravity by using a discretized path integral of the BF theory with polynomial interactions and the Barrett–Crane ansatz. In the Euclidean gravity case, we obtain a vertex amplitude which is determined by a vertex operator acting on a simple spin network function. The Euclidean gravity results can be straightforwardly extended to the Lorentzian case, so that we propose a Lorentzian spin foam model of Yang–Mills theory coupled to gravity.
